GE Healthcare is showcasing two of its newest process-scale instrumentation for protein purification: the AKTAprocess system for chromatographic purification and the UniFlux system for membrane separation. Both systems are controlled by UNICORN software, which facilitates communication between the two as well as scale-up from smaller systems. GE Advanced Materials, Silicones, which is continuing to develop biocompatible(1) materials for applications such as fluid and drug delivery devices, peristaltic pump tubing, transfer hose and tubing, and laboratory septa and accessories will exhibit several products and services. GE's new Tufel* III elastomer is a two-component, platinum-cure silicone elastomer that provides high resilience and elastic memory, as well as low hysteresis, for flow accuracy and improved pump life performance. GE Analytical Instruments, a division of GE Water & Process Technologies, is launching its new Sievers 500 RL On-Line TOC Analyzer. Utilizing the proven Sievers laboratory TOC measurement technology, the highly automated Sievers 500 RL delivers science-based risk management capability to the production floor for Process Analytical Technology and other quality initiatives such as real-time pharmaceutical water release and on-line cleaning validation.
